The Siemens 3RP1505-1RW30 is a versatile timing relay designed to meet the demands of various industrial automation applications. This multifunctional relay offers a wide range of timing functions, making it suitable for diverse operational requirements. It features two change-over contacts and supports eight different functions, providing flexibility in control and automation tasks.

With a robust design, the 3RP1505-1RW30 operates within a voltage range of 24 to 240V AC/DC at 50/60 Hz, ensuring compatibility with various power systems. The relay is equipped with positively driven and gold-plated contacts, enhancing reliability and longevity. It offers 15 selectable time ranges from 0.05 seconds to 100 hours, allowing precise control over timing operations.

The relay's compact dimensions (22.5 x 91 x 102 mm) and snap-on mounting capability make it easy to install in tight spaces and on standard 35 mm DIN rails. It is designed to operate in a wide temperature range from -25°C to +60°C, ensuring reliable performance in harsh environments.

Specification Description
Part Number 3RP1505-1RW30
Manufacturer Siemens
Product Brand Name SIRIUS
Product Designation Timing Relay
Product Type Designation 3RP15
Functions 8 functions
Time Ranges 15 time ranges (0.05 s - 100 h)
Contacts 2 change-over contacts
Contact Material AgSnO2
Control Supply Voltage 24-240 V AC/DC
Control Supply Voltage Frequency 50/60 Hz
Protection Class IP IP20
Mounting Type Screw and snap-on mounting onto 35 mm standard mounting rail
Mounting Position Any
Dimensions (W x H x D) 22.5 x 102 x 91 mm
Ambient Temperature (Operation) -25 to +60 °C
Ambient Temperature (Storage) -40 to +85 °C
Relative Humidity (Operation) 10 to 95%
Mechanical Service Life 10,000,000 switching cycles
Electrical Endurance 100,000 switching cycles at AC-15 at 230 V
Adjustable Time 0.05 s to 100 h
Thermal Current 5 A
Minimum ON Period 35 ms
Recovery Time 150 ms
Insulation Voltage 300 V (overvoltage category III, pollution degree 3)
Test Voltage for Isolation 2 kV
Surge Voltage Resistance 4,000 V
Shock Resistance 11g / 15 ms (IEC 60068-2-27)
Vibration Resistance 10-55 Hz / 0.35 mm (IEC 60068-2-6)
EMI Immunity EN 61000-6-2
Conducted Interference 2 kV network connection / 1 kV control connection (IEC 61000-4-4)
Electrostatic Discharge 4 kV contact discharge / 8 kV air discharge (IEC 61000-4-2)
Field-bound Parasitic Coupling 10 V/m (IEC 61000-4-3)
Conductor Cross-section (Solid) 0.5 - 4 mm²
Conductor Cross-section (Stranded) 0.5 - 2.5 mm²
AWG Conductor Cross-section (Solid) 20 - 14
AWG Conductor Cross-section (Stranded) 20 - 14
Tightening Torque 0.8 - 1.2 N·m
Connection Screw Thread M3
Required Spacing (Side-by-side Mounting) 0 mm in all directions
Installation Altitude Up to 2,000 m above sea level
Product Function Removable terminal for auxiliary and control circuit
Type of Electrical Connection Screw-type terminals
Conductor-bound Parasitic Coupling (Surge) 1 kV (IEC 61000-4-5)
Conductor-bound Parasitic Coupling (Burst) 2 kV network connection / 1 kV control connection (IEC 61000-4-4)
Field-bound Parasitic Coupling 10 V/m (IEC 61000-4-3)
Electrostatic Discharge 4 kV contact discharge / 8 kV air discharge (IEC 61000-4-2)
Protection Against Electrical Shock Finger-safe
Type of Insulation Basic insulation
Category (EN 954-1) None
Power Loss 2 W
Reference Code (DIN EN 81346-2) K
Reference Code (DIN 40719) K
